Computing Safety Center:
The BlueCollarPC.Net website and Web Group are dedicated to Computing Safety. A few years ago it seemed the biggest Security decision was too add Anti-Virus Software to the Computer. This was recommended and probably included with purchase. In recent time, and now the 21st Century, it is recommended now to have at least three basic Security softwares in place - installed on your Computer, active and in constant use. These absolute neccessities are now: Anti-Virus Software, a Firewall, and Anti - Spy/AdWare Software. Without these, you are at risk concerning ID and Peronal Data theft - and also loosing your Computer to misusing persons in various ways.

CWShredder http://www.intermute.com/spysubtract/cwshredder_download.html CWShredder finds and destroys traces of CoolWebSearch. CoolWebSearch is a name given to a wide range of different browser hijackers. Though the code is very different between variants, they are all used to redirect users to coolwebsearch.com and other sites affiliated with its operators. Learn More: http://www.intermute.com/cwshredder/learn_more_cwshredder.html (Note: CoolWebSearch has been reported as the worst, and the CWShredder is the only known true remover for all traces, variants - and is constantly updated. CWSredder has been aquired by Trend Micro AntiSpyware now but is still free as a stand alone program from them. Take a look at the extensive variants list of the CoolWebSearch toolbar browser hijacker at CA Spyware Information Center......): CA Spyware Information Center (List of CWS variants) http://www3.ca.com/securityadvisor/pest/pest.aspx?id=453076035

BHODemon - utility [working-freeware] http://www.pcworld.com/downloads/file_description/0,fid,23611,00.asp Internet Explorer has a nasty habit of allowing so-called Browser Helper Objects (or BHOs) to install themselves into IE. Some BHOs are helpful, like the Google Toolbar, but others (especially those planted by viruses or spyware) can be malicious and harmful. BHODemon gives you a quick look at the BHOs installed on your PC, tells you whether a specific BHO is known to be safe or harmful, and gives you the ability to enable or disable individual BHOs with a single mouse click.

IE-SPYAD: Restricted Sites List for Internet Explorer [working-freeware] https://netfiles.uiuc.edu/ehowes/www/resource.htm IE-SPYAD adds a long list of sites and domains associated with known advertisers, marketers, and crapware pushers to the Restricted sites zone of Internet Explorer. Once you merge this list of sites and domains into the Registry, the web sites for these companies will not be able to use cookies, ActiveX controls, Java applets, or scripting to compromise your privacy or your PC while you surf the Net. Nor will they be able to use your browser to push unwanted pop-ups, cookies, or auto-installing programs on your PC. (NOTE: Example: Open Explorer >click Tools, click > Internet Options, > click Security, > click Restricted Sites. There you may manually (normally) add any website you wish to restrict Explorer from accessing by clicking > Sites and typing in the web address. This utility adds hundreds almost instantaneously - do the math on the time you save !)

How do I know if my PC is infected ? 
Most likely one or both things can start to happen or more. Your Computer slows down browsing - sluggish, bloated, slow. Also, you may suddenly find new tool bars. There may be new links in your Favorites that you certainly did not bookmark. You may even see some new desktop shortcut icons. Checking the search engines or news stories about sluggish computers you might go down the avenue that you may need to increase your computer memory which is like a $100.00 memory addition - from 256K to 512K. Most likely you have a variety of events occurring from various types of adware, spyware, or other data miners or even trojans and worms, and other little 'badwares' called scumware, parasites, and malware of various kinds. You may start out going to help forums about getting rid of that stupid toolbar you did not install and wondered how it got there. Other weird things may be occurring like hitting your homepage and it is going somewhere else. Your browser has been hi-jacked ! (BHO Browser Help Objects). That is what this webpage is all about - because once you do enter the community of help and information about these operational and confidential intrusions you are going to find that you are probably going to end up doing a complete spring cleaning of your Computer. The more items you find you back track in your mind about I wonder what that leaked and to who - according to the severity of the "badware" found. It is possible to find up to 100 items, even more, which kind of constitutes your Computer to be what is called "infested". There is now great types of software that will get rid of practically everything. But the industry and consumers have found some items that need "manual removal". This involves many times of going into the computer Registry to delete items and also deletion of certain individual associated files. This is a second phase that needs some real investigation. There is always the warning here about registry deletions - if you delete a Registry item you are unsure of you may render your Computer completely inoperable or software programs installed. So, it takes a little homework to know what you are looking at when deleting files or Registry items for confidence in "clean removals". Welcome to the road of "Computer Health" .

Obscure: If purchased as a valid software, it may be employed as "trialware protection" for various products: SEE: "The presence of SVKP.SYS does not necessarily mean that this trojan is installed. SVKP.SYS is part of SVK Protector, which this trojan is packed with. SVK Protector is used in innocent programs as well. http://vil.nai.com/vil/content/v_101134.htm"
